i no longer have my genIV SS, but this is a parts list directly from the instructions (the number in front is the quantity of each):
2 Steering Post 4 M5x8x2.5 Bearing 2 Spacer 1 Spring Post 1 LowerBellCrank 1 M10 E-Ring 1 Rigid Bellcrank 1 DragLink 1 Spring 2 Shoulder Screw 1 Upper Bellcrank |
